Pork Shoulder Butt Roast, Bone-In
Our Bone-In Pork Shoulder Butt is tender, delicious, and easy to cook. Sometimes called Boston butt, blade roast, pork butt, the way to prepare it is simple - low and slow. Braising, smoking, roasting, grilling, or slow cooking are all great ways to create delicious meals that people love. With just a few additions, you can easily put carnitas, pizza, tacos, stew, or sandwiches on the table.
